Points To Consider When Contracting Machine Hire Company

Plant machinery is employed in a vast range of locations, including on construction sites, mining sites, military bases, and by the oil and refinery industries. There is a wide array of plant equipment available in the market. Anyhow, buying heavy equipment and machinery would be extremely costly and the best option is to make the best use of the offers, by plant hire companies. A heavy equipment on hire supplier offers an extensive variety of machinery/s and attachments to complete many assignments.

All things considered, 1.5 to 3% of any construction/manufacture/production project budget is spent on equipment hire, and this number is increasing rapidly as savvy contractors look to evade the superfluous capital use and proprietorship costs, that go with purchasing a new plant. So, on a £1m project, a contractor is likely to spend somewhere in the range of £15,000 and £30,000, on hiring the required machinery/s. In light of such critical consumption, it is imperative that these businesses pick their hire supplier with caution.

Three points to keep in mind are:

Skill and experience : Experienced staff have the knowledge to make sure you get the best suitable piece of equipment for your job unfailingly. Utilizing the wrong equipment can cost you money on wasted hire, derail your project or may cause a casualty on your site. At the most, you may be paying exorbitantly for machinery you don't require or losing time using the improper equipment. At the least, you may hurt somebody and have your site shut down.

Logistics : Check that the company providing machine hire Bristol has a warehouse network, that provides adequate coverage of the areas you work in. Low-cost hire rates mean little in the event that you should incur inordinate delivery and collection charges. Additionally, a hire company with an extensive transport fleet can save you money by employing the proper vehicle to transport your selected equipment.

The range of stock : Using services of a machine hire Bristol with a large and multifarious equipment implies they will probably supply, all that you require under one roof. Working with one supplier, where possible, let you negotiate discount depending on the volume of business, thus saving a bit extra.

Conclusion

So, do an analysis of your hire costs and your hire supplier. Keep in mind, it's not just about the rates.
